Abstract
An electric hoist wire detection protection controller comprises an electric control box and a motor, wherein the steel wire of the fixed end of a drum cover is connected with an oblique tension resistant sensor, an ascending sensor and an ascending limit senor, the left side of the drum cover is fixed with a descending sensor and a descending limit sensor, the sensors output electric signals via an output to a calculation CPU which signal output is connected with a ULN2803 drive module via wires, the output of the ULN2803 drive module is connected with each execution relay which normal-closed contact is assessed into the loop of an alternative current contact voltage coil in the electric control box, and the signal output of the electric control box is connected with the motor via wires. The electric hoist wire detection protection controller has the advantages of high sensitivity, long service life, simple installment, safe and reliable application and simple maintenance.

The specific embodiment:
Describe embodiment in detail in conjunction with above accompanying drawing, be connected with on the reel outer cover fixed end steel rope and prevent oblique pull sensor 8, rising sensor 7, rising limit sensor 6, reel outer cover left side is fixed with decline sensor 5, falling-threshold sensor 4, the sensor is exported electric signal respectively and is delivered to CPU 9 computings through mouth, signal output part connects ULN2803 driver module 10 respectively by lead after CPU 9 computings, ULN2803 driver module 10 mouths connect respectively carries out relay 11, the long closed contact of carrying out relay 11 inserts in the loop that exchanges the contact potential coil in the electric appliance control box 12, the signal output part of control box 12 is connected with motor respectively by lead, and above-mentioned execution relay 11 is by the CD relay, the MD relay, CD falling-threshold relay, MD falling-threshold relay, always stop relay, left lateral actuated small roadster relay, right lateral actuated small roadster relay, the big sport car relay of left lateral, the big sport car relay of right lateral is formed.Motor 13 is by CD motor, MD motor, and actuated small roadster motor, big sport car motor are formed.During normal operation, lifting/ lowering sensor 5,7 and anti-oblique pull sensor 8 equal no signals export, the controller testing is normal, the CD motor, the MD motor, the actuated small roadster motor, big sport car motor is carried out lifting/lowering respectively, about operation work, when the electric block liter, when falling the value of overstepping the extreme limit or tiltedly drawing angle to transfinite, the displacement of this moment is passed to lifting sensor 5 by transferring structure, 7, deliver to CPU 9 computings through the input end electric signal, carry out signal shaping, screen, judge, deliver to ULN2803 driver module 10 by mouth after the delay process, tiltedly draw processing signals to deliver to the AC contactor J01 of 12 li of electric appliance control boxes through mouth, thereby cut off CD, MD promotes the power supply and the actuated small roadster motor of motor, power supply on the big sport car motor, the AC contactor J06 that electric appliance control box is 12 li, J07, J08, J09 cuts off the power supply respectively.
When if the adhesion of lifting motor ac contactor contact takes place, the CD motor, the MD motor will work on, driving device on the rising limit sensor 6 still has certain displacement, thereby promoting sensor makes it export the transducing signal that cuts off general supply immediately, judge that through CPU 9 output CD/MD motor cuts off the power supply immediately, quit work, electric block will all cut off the power supply this moment, as recovering machine operation, after the AC contactor of necessary replacing or reparation adhesion, use manual reset switch 2 or press the wireless remote controller 1 that resets, send reset signal and through input end signal is delivered to computing CPU 9 after wireless receiving reseting module 2 receives, make it after new initial optimization, electric block can be from new work.
The design's computing CPU selects PIC micro controller system series of products for use.
